Might-E Truck is a fully electric, mid-sized work vehicle manufactured by Canadian Electric Vehicles in British Columbia, Canada. It is designed for use as a utility, work, urban or leisure vehicle and is manufactured using solely standard North American automotive parts. With a top speed of 40 km/h (25 mph), Might-E Truck is road legal and meets the requirements for a low speed vehicle or neighborhood electric vehicle.
